Lisa Hunt is the Rector of St. Stephen’s Episcopal Church and President of the Board of Trustees of St. Stephen’s Episcopal School. She is responsible for the spiritual life of the Church and School community including worship, formation, and pastoral care. She is an alumna of the General Theological Seminary and Vanderbilt Divinity School; she received her undergraduate degree from the University of Toledo in Ohio.

Her current interests include urban development and affordable housing; she serves on the Montrose Tax Increment Reinvestment Zone board for the city of Houston, chairing its Affordable Housing committee. She is married to Bruce Farrar; together they have three children: Annie, Max, and Rose. Their two grandchildren, Maya and Alton, are the apples of their eyes.

Ashley Dellagiacoma is the Associate Rector of St. Stephen’s Episcopal Church.  Prior to joining St. Stephen’s, Ashley was pastor of Kindred in Montrose. A native Houstonian, she studied Business at Texas Lutheran University (TLU) and received an M. Div. from Luther Seminary in Minneapolis. After seminary, she served as Vicar of Christ Lutheran Church of Brenham, Texas, and as Youth and Education Minister of the Abiding Love Lutheran Church in Austin, Texas. Ashley has also worked in development and fundraising at TLU and at Presbyterian Children’s Homes and Services in Austin, Texas. She enjoys camping, poetry, gardening, art, and backyard chickens.
